Silents can have different meanings depending on the context. One possible meaning of "silents" is a term used to refer to the era of silent films in the early 20th century. Now, you might be wondering, what are silent films? Well, imagine watching a movie without any sound. Yes, that's right, a film without any dialogue or background music. During the earlier days of filmmaking, before the invention of synchronized sound, movies relied solely on visuals to tell a story. Without actors' voices or sound effects, filmmakers had to rely on exaggerated facial expressions, gestures, and text displayed on the screen to convey the story to the audience. It was truly a unique and captivating form of entertainment that allowed people's imagination to run wild. So, when someone mentions "silents," they could be referring to that remarkable era of film history when movies were completely silent, but still managed to capture the hearts and minds of audiences all over the world.
